How much do assistant mining research analyst j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 9, 2026, the average yearly pay for assistant mining research analyst in the United States is $71,673.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$49,000.00 and $83,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Strategic Ventures is currently recruiting an Operations Research Analyst to join our team at Ft. Meade, Maryland.  


The most qualified candidate will:

  • Serve as an operations research analyst conducting operations research analysis in support of the assessment of cyberspace operations. 
  • Devise modeling and measuring techniques to investigate complex issues, identify and solve problems, and aid better decision making for strategic assessments. 
  • Apply or develop technologies and concepts to assist in advancing the assessment of cyberspace operations. Assist in addressing requirements and the evaluation of data assessment strategies, including sampling, statistical analysis, evaluation, flow processing, and management assessment strategies. 
  • Apply operations research expertise to executive-level projects and analyze, assess, and develop future strategic assessments related to cyberspace operations.

Requirements

Required Qualifications:

  • 10+ years of experience as an operations research analyst
  • Ability to pay strict attention to detail
  •  TS/SCI with CI Polygraph
  • Bachelor's degree in Operations Research, CS, Cybersecurity, or Computer Engineering
